이 글에서는 기술적 분석 원리를 LSTM 신경망 아키텍처와 통합하여 볼륨 분석을 기반으로 가격을 예측하는 것을 개선할 수 있는 가능성에 대해 알아봅니다. 특히 이상 볼륨의 탐지 및 해석, 클러스터링 활용, 볼륨 기반의 피처 생성 및 이들에 대해 머신 러닝 맥락에서의 정의에 중점을 둡니다.
이 문서에서는 다중 통화 포트폴리오 최적화를 위한 VaR(위험가중치) 모델이 가진 잠재력에 대해 살펴봅니다. 파이썬의 강력한 성능과 MetaTrader 5의 기능을 사용하여 효율적인 자본 배분 및 포지션 관리를 하는 VaR 분석을 구현하는 방법에 대해 알아봅니다. 이론적 기초부터 실제 구현까지, 알고리즘 트레이딩에서 가장 강력한 위험 계산 시스템 중 하나인 VaR을 적용하는 모든 측면을 다룹니다.
MQL5 프리랜스는 개발자가 트레이더 고객을 위한 트레이딩 애플리케이션을 만들어 주고 그 대가를 금전적으로 받는 온라인 서비스입니다. 이 서비스는 2010년부터 성공적으로 운영되어 현재까지 100,000개 이상의 총 7백만 달러의 프로젝트가 완료되었습니다. 보시다시피 여기에는 상당한 금액이 관련됩니다.
MQL5 Algo Forge 저장소의 모든 리포지토리에서 외부 코드를 프로젝트에 통합하는 방법을 살펴보겠습니다. 이 글에서는 유용하면서도 더 복잡한 작업, 즉 MQL5 Algo Forge 내에서 타사 저장소의 라이브러리를 실제로 연결하고 사용하는 방법에 대해 살펴봅니다.
트레이딩 시스템을 만들 때 효과적으로 처리해야 하는 작업이 있습니다. 이 작업은 주문 접수 또는 생성된 트레이딩 시스템이 자동으로 주문을 처리하도록 하는 작업으로 모든 트레이딩 시스템에서 매우 중요합니다. 따라서 이 기사에서는 주문 접수의 측면에서 거래 시스템을 효과적으로 만들기 위해 여러분이 이해해야 하는 대부분의 주제를 찾을 수 있습니다.
MetaEditor에서 프로젝트를 작업할 때 개발자는 종종 코드 버전을 관리해야 하는 상황에 직면합니다. MetaQuotes는 최근 코드 버전 관리 및 협업 기능을 갖춘 MQL5 Algo Forge의 출시와 함께 GIT로의 마이그레이션을 발표했습니다. 이 글에서는 이 새로운 도구와 기존 도구를 더 효율적으로 사용하는 방법에 대해 설명합니다.
알고리즘 트레이딩 개발자를 위한 전용 포털인 MQL5 Algo Forge를 소개합니다. MQL5 Algo Forge에는 Git의 강력한 기능과 MQL5 에코시스템 내에서 프로젝트를 관리하고 구성할 수 있는 직관적인 인터페이스가 결합되어 있습니다. 여러분은 이곳에서 흥미로운 저자를 팔로우하고 팀을 구성하고 알고리즘 트레이딩 프로젝트에 대해 협업할 수 있습니다.
MetaTrader 5 플랫폼의 사용자 인터페이스는 여러 언어로 번역되었습니다. 만약 당신이 사용하는 언어로는 번역되지 않았더라도 실망하기엔 이릅니다. MetaQuotes Software Corp.이 제공하는 MetaTrader 5 멀티랭귀지 팩 유틸리티를 이용하여 쉽게 번역할 수 있기 때문이죠. 심지어 공짜입니다. 본 문서에서는 MetaTrader 5 플랫폼에 새로운 사용자 인터페이스 언어를 추가하는 예시에 대해서 보여드릴 것입니다.
프로그래밍 언어로 된 모든 프로그램에는 특정한 구조가 있습니다. 이 글에서는 MetaTrader 5에서 실행 가능한 MQL5 거래 시스템 또는 거래 도구를 만들 때 매우 유용한 MQL5 프로그램 구조의 모든 부분에 대한 프로그래밍의 기초를 이해함으로써 MQL5 프로그램 구조의 필수 부분을 학습할 수 있습니다.
Marekt을 통해 전 세계 수백만 명의 MetaTrader 사용자에게 트레이딩 애플리케이션을 제공하십시오. 이미 구축된 인프라가 있습니다: 많은 사용자, 라이선스 솔루션, 평가판, 업데이트 게시 및 결제등의 인프라를 활용할 수 있습니다. 간단한 판매자 등록 절차를 완료하고 제품을 게시하기만 하면 됩니다. 이러한 서비스를 통해 저희가 구축해 놓은 각종 기술들을 사용해서 귀하의 프로그램을 만들어 추가적인 수익을 창출 하십시오.
이 기사에서는 MetaTrader 4 및 5 거래에서 자동화 체인 전체를 닫을 수 있을 뿐만 아니라 훨씬 더 흥미로운 작업을 할 수 있게 해준 개선 사항의 첫 번째 부분을 보여드리겠습니다. 이제부터는 이 솔루션을 사용하면 EA를 생성하고 최적화하는 것을 완전히 자동화할 수 있을 뿐만 아니라 효과적인 트레이딩 구성을 찾는 데 드는 인건비를 최소화할 수 있습니다.
머신러닝은 전략 개발을 위한 인기 있는 방법이 되었습니다. 수익성과 예측 정확도를 극대화하는 데는 더 많은 관심이 집중되었지만 예측 모델을 구축하는 데 사용되는 데이터 처리의 중요성은 그다지 주목을 받지 못했습니다. 이 글에서는 티모시 마스터스의 책 '시장 트레이딩 시스템 테스트 및 조정'에 설명된 대로 엔트로피 개념을 사용해 예측 모델 구축에 사용할 지표의 적절성을 평가하는 방법을 살펴봅니다.
개발자는 특히 서로 다른 동작을 하는 여러 객체가 있는 경우 중복된 코드 없이 재사용이 가능하면서 유연한 소프트웨어를 만들고 개발하는 방법을 알아야 합니다. 객체 지향 프로그래밍 기술과 원칙을 사용하면 이를 원활하게 수행할 수 있습니다. 이 글에서는 MQL5 객체 지향 프로그래밍의 기초를 소개하고 소프트웨어에서 그 원칙과 사례를 어떻게 활용할 수 있는지 알아보고자 합니다.